Understanding Treadmills: Types, Benefits, and Considerations
Treadmills have ended up being an essential part of physical fitness culture, using a hassle-free option for individuals looking for to improve their cardiovascular physical fitness without the need for outdoor areas or weather condition factors to consider. With a range of features and models readily available, prospective purchasers should be well-informed to make the best decision. This post intends to provide a detailed introduction of treadmills, consisting of the various types, benefits, and elements to think about when purchasing one.
The Different Types of Treadmills1. Handbook Treadmills
Manual treadmills are powered by the user rather than an electric motor. They require no electrical power and generally include a simple style with less moving parts.
Benefits of Manual Treadmills:Cost-effectivePortable and lightweightNo dependence on electrical powerDisadvantages:Limited featuresTypically lack slope choices2. Motorized Treadmills
Motorized treadmills are the most typical type, powered by an electric motor. They normally use numerous features such as programmable exercise routines, adjustable slopes, and greater weight capacities.
Benefits of Motorized Treadmills:Smooth operation and consistent tractionVersatile with innovative features for different workoutsOptions for incline and decrease settingsDrawbacks:Higher cost compared to manual treadmillsRequire electricity and might increase electric bills3. Folding Treadmills
Folding treadmills are designed for simple storage, making them perfect for those with minimal area.
Advantages of Folding Treadmills:Space-saving styleEasy to carry and storeAppropriate for home usage where area is at a premiumDownsides:Typically may have a smaller running surfaceWeight limitation might be lower than non-folding models4. Industrial Treadmills
These treadmills are developed for sturdiness and efficiency, normally discovered in health clubs and physical fitness centers. They are created for high usage rates and come with advanced functions.

Treadmills use various advantages for people looking to improve their fitness levels or keep an athletic regimen.
1. Convenience
Owning a treadmill allows users to work out at their own schedule, getting rid of reliance on weather conditions. It supplies flexibility, as workouts can happen day or night.
2. Customizable Workouts
Numerous contemporary treadmills feature adjustable programs to accommodate novices and experienced professional athletes. Users can adjust speed, incline, and exercise duration to maximize the effectiveness of their sessions.
3. Tracking Progress
Most treadmills come equipped with digital displays that record important statistics such as range, speed, calories burned, and heart rate. Monitoring this data helps users track their fitness development with time.
4. Reduced Impact
Treadmills typically supply a cushioned surface area that can lower joint effect compared to operating on difficult outside surface areas, making them a suitable alternative for people with joint concerns or those recovering from injuries.
5. Variety of Workouts
Users can participate in different exercises on a treadmill, from walking and running to interval training and speed work. Some machines even offer built-in courses that simulate outside surfaces.

What is the average life-span of a treadmill?
Typically, a high-quality treadmill can last between 7 to 12 years, depending on use, maintenance, and construct quality.
2. What is the very best treadmill brand?
Popular brands consist of NordicTrack, Sole Fitness, Precor, and LifeSpan, each understood for their quality and consumer fulfillment.
3. Can I use a treadmill for walking?
Yes, treadmills are best for walking, jogging, or running, making them versatile for users of all fitness levels.
4. How often should I service my treadmill?
Regular maintenance is generally recommended every 6 months to guarantee optimal performance and longevity.
5. Is it okay to run on a treadmill every day?
While operating on a treadmill daily is acceptable for some, it's a good idea to incorporate day of rest or alternate exercises to prevent prospective overuse injuries.
